BASIC FUNCTION
The Slipaway shuttle driver provides transportation for guests and employees, ensuring timely and safe arrivals and departures along a set route or on-demand. In addition to driving, this position requires strong customer service skills and the ability to act as a Slipaway ambassador, answering guest questions and providing a positive first and last impression. A Slipaway shuttle driver is responsible for safely and courteously transporting guests between Slipaway properties, remote parking lot and other designated destinations. As a highly visible member of the guest services staff, the driver provides excellent customer service, assists guests, and maintains the cleanliness and safety of the vehicle.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Guest transportation: Safely transport guests and employees to and from designated locations in a timely manner. This includes trips within the Slipaway, to remote parking lot and other designated locations
 - Customer service: Greet guests warmly, assist with boarding and exiting the vehicle.
 - Guest information: Answer questions about Slipaway’s facilities, services, and local points of interest. Make recommendations as appropriate.
 - Vehicle maintenance and safety:
- Conduct pre-trip and post-trip vehicle inspections, including checking tires, fluids, and fuel levels.
 - Keep the vehicle clean and presentable, both inside and out, at all times.
 - Report any vehicle damage, safety concerns, or maintenance needs to management immediately.
 - Follow all traffic laws and safety regulations.
 
 - Operational communication: Communicate with the guest service team, and other drivers via radio to coordinate schedules, report delays, and respond to guest requests.
 - Administrative tasks: Maintain accurate records of trips, including passenger counts and mileage.
 
QUALIFICATIONS
- A valid driver's license with a clean driving record is essential.
 - A Commercial Driver's License (CDL) with a passenger endorsement may be required, depending on the size of the vehicle.
 - Must pass a pre-employment drug screening and background check.
 - Ability to work a flexible schedule, including days, nights, weekends, and holidays.
 - Physical ability to lift heavy luggage, up to 50 lbs., and sit or stand for long periods.
 
SKILLS AND COMPETENCIES
- Excellent customer service: Possesses a friendly, outgoing, and professional demeanor, with a passion for serving others.
 - Safe driving practices: Exhibits expert knowledge of traffic laws and defensive driving skills.
 - Communication: Demonstrates strong verbal communication skills for interacting with guests and coordinating with staff.
 - Problem-solving: Maintains a calm and professional attitude in challenging situations, such as traffic or unexpected delays.
 - Knowledgeable: Becomes familiar with the Slipaway and local area to provide accurate information to guests.
 - Reliable and punctual: Ensures timely pickups and drop-offs to maintain schedule efficiency.
